#451b1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#451b1d is composed of 27.1% red, 10.6%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.9% magenta, 58%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 18.8%. #451b1d color hex could be obtained by blending #8a363a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#451b1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#451b1d has RGB values of R:69, G:27,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.58,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4528925.

Shades and Tints of #451b1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0505 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#451b1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#332d2e is the less saturated color, while #5f0106 is the most saturated one.
